Job description
Key Responsibilities
  • Perform MIG, TIG, and Arc welding in workshop settings
  • Fabricate and assemble structural steel and metal components
  • Interpret and work from technical drawings
  • Maintain high-quality standards and adhere to welding procedures
  • Ensure a clean, organized, and safe workshop environment
What We’re Looking For
  • Certificate III in Metal Fabrication essential
  • Strong MIG/TIG/Arc welding and fabrication skills
  • Attention to detail with a focus on quality workmanship
  • Strong health and safety awareness
